Wooden fence repair services involve restoring and maintaining the structural integrity and appearance of existing wooden fences. These services typically include replacing broken or rotting boards, fixing loose or sagging panels, and reinforcing fence posts that have become unstable. Skilled contractors assess the condition of the entire fence to identify areas needing attention and perform targeted repairs to extend the lifespan of the fence and ensure it continues to serve its purpose effectively.
Fences often face issues such as warping, splintering, and damage caused by weather, pests, or general wear over time. Repair services help address these problems by replacing damaged sections, tightening loose components, and applying treatments to prevent future deterioration. Proper repair work not only improves the visual appeal of a property but also enhances privacy, security, and boundary definition, making it a practical solution for homeowners dealing with aging or damaged fences.

The overview below groups typical Wooden Fence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Omaha, NE.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or fence repairs, such as replacing broken pickets or fixing loose posts, generally range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of damage and materials needed.
Moderate Restoration - For more extensive repairs like replacing sections of fencing or repairing multiple posts, local contractors often charge between $600-$1,500. Projects in this range are common when restoring older fences or addressing moderate wear.
Full Fence Replacement - Complete replacement of a wooden fence can cost from $1,500-$4,000, with larger or more complex projects potentially reaching $5,000 or more. Many homeowners opt for this option when repairs are no longer cost-effective.
Custom or Large-Scale Projects - Custom designs, privacy fences, or large properties may see costs exceeding $5,000, depending on size and complexity. These projects are less common but handled by local pros for those seeking tailored fencing solutions.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of damage can be repaired on a wooden fence? Local contractors can handle repairs for common issues such as broken or rotting boards, loose or leaning panels, damaged posts, and weather-related wear to restore the fence's condition.
How do professionals typically repair rotting or damaged fence boards? Service providers often replace or reinforce compromised boards, ensuring the fence maintains its stability and appearance.
Can a damaged fence be reinforced without complete replacement? Yes, experienced contractors can often repair or reinforce specific sections of a wooden fence to extend its lifespan without needing full replacement.
What should I do if my fence posts are leaning or unstable? Local service providers can stabilize or replace leaning or damaged fence posts to ensure the fence remains secure and upright.
Are repairs to wooden fences affected by weather or seasonal conditions? Weather and seasonal factors can influence repair methods, and local contractors can advise on the best approach based on current conditions.
